Scapy scapy is a powerful python based interactive packet manipulation program and library. How to download and install mysqldb module for python on. Mysql connector python developer guide connector python installation obtaining connector python. Apr 28, 2020 in order to work with mysql using python, you must have some knowledge of sql. Install 64bit mysqldb for python 3 on windows 7 grayshirt. Mysqldb is an interface to the popular mysql database server for python. In order to work with mysql using python, you must have some knowledge of sql. For the love of physics walter lewin may 16, 2011 duration.
Dec 26, 2018 installing mysqldb for python 3 in windows my favorite python connector for mysql or mariadb is mysqldb, the problem with this connector is that it is complicated to install on windows. Historically, most, but not all, python releases have also been gplcompatible. Ubuntu details of package python3mysqldb in xenial. Nov 29, 2018 to install python mysqldb module, we need to install python current version i. Clinic management system healthcare computer system, commonly known as clinic management system, is created to computerize ma. In this tutorial we will use the driver mysql connector. Gallery about documentation support about anaconda, inc. Filename, size file type python version upload date hashes. If you are familiar with these things you may jump to the installation process below. In this python tutorial, we will talk about how to install mysql connector in python. This file will download from python s developer website.
The choice of 32bit and 64bit depends on the version of python you have installed in your computer and not in the operating system or the server. In fact, the official documentation says this is the recommended. Otherwise youll get a staticallylinked module, which may or may not be what you want. To install python mysqldb module, we need to install python current version i. To import the module, insert the following into a python program or simply type it in a following python shell. For most unix systems, you must download and compile the source code.
Mysql is an opensource database and one of the best type of rdbms relational database management system. The data base adapter for python, mysqldb, has had its own issues. The shared module options build a shared library for the python mysqldb module that is loaded at python runtime. We suggest that you use the md5 checksums and gnupg signatures to verify the integrity of the packages you download. How can i install the mysqldb module for python using pip. The package that you want is mysqlconnector python. The same source code archive can also be used to build. Python needs a mysql driver to access the mysql database. Mysql for python mysql database connector for python programming. The name of the project mysql for python is the current version of a project that began under the rubric mysqldb.
Installing mysqldb for python 3 in windows my favorite python connector for mysql or mariadb is mysqldb, the problem with this connector is that it is complicated to install on windows. Openshot video editor openshot video editor is a powerful yet very simple and easytouse video editor that delivers high. Is it python mysqldb, or mysqldb, or mysqldb, mysqlclient. Install mysql connector python on windows, mac, linux, unix. Mysqldb is an interface to the popular mysql database server that provides the python database api. Mysqldb is an interface for connecting to a mysql database server from python. Oracle mysql cloud service is built on mysql enterprise edition and powered by oracle cloud, providing an enterprisegrade mysql database service. The python package manager comes with python, called pip. It downloads the package from the pypi repository and installs it in an automatic location based on what version of python or what virtual copy you use to install it.
Python tutorials for beginners pythonmysql connector. Its easy to do, but hard to remember the correct spelling. How to download and install setuptools module for python. Mysql connector for python is a database driver that can. Mysql cluster is a realtime open source transactional database designed for fast, alwayson access to data under high throughput conditions.
First, open the cmd and reach the location of python scripts. The licenses page details gplcompatibility and terms and conditions. Use the following command to install mysql connector python on ubuntu. I am creating this article for those who want to install mysqldb for python 3 for windows. The readme file has complete installation instructions. Mysqldevel to compile mysqlshared if you want to use their shared library.
Little did i know that since i had chosen to go with python 3, i was in for several evenings of pain and agony dealing with mysqldb. Tutorial getting started with mysql in python datacamp. As a result you need to use python 2 for this tutorial. Debian details of package pythonmysqldb in stretch. Mysql connector python is the official oraclesupported driver to connect mysql through python. This package contains a pure python mysql client library, based on pep 249 most public apis are compatible with mysqlclient and mysqldb. But some apis like autocommit and ping are supported because pep 249 doesnt cover their. Installing mysqldb for python 3 in windows radish logic. Mysqldb dont yet have support for python 3, it supports only python 2. I hope this fork is merged back to mysqldb1 like distribute was merged back to setuptools.
In this article, we will walk through how to install mysql connector python on windows, macos, linux, and unix and ubuntu using pip and vis source code. Code pull requests 0 actions projects 0 security insights. Mysql driver written in python which does not depend on mysql c client libraries and implements the db api v2. Download python mysqldb packages for debian, ubuntu. Before you can access mysql databases using python, you must install one or more of the following packages in a virtual environment. If youre not sure which to choose, learn more about installing packages. Mysqldb is an api for accessing mysql database using python. This change makes it easy and intuitive to decide which client version to use for which server version. If you want to write applications which are portable across databases, use mysqldb, and avoid using this module directly. Download all aspersa mysql toolsscripts through a single command. I believe that when i had anaconda3 in my global path and the other version of python in my user path, i was able to install mysqlclient.
After an emotional rollercoaster of build path fuckery that made me want to claw my eyes out, i finally got it working. Mysql connector python is a standardized database driver for python platforms and development. So before jumping to installation lets talk about why we need this mysql connector and a little bit introduction. How to install mysql python mysqldb easy way windows 7 windows 8 windows 10 64bits. Sign up for free see pricing for teams and enterprises. Mysql download mysql connectorpython archived versions. This is a fork of mysqldb1 this project adds python 3 support and bug fixes.
How to install mysql connector in python codespeedy. To connect to a mysql server from python, you need a database driver module. Initially, i am just trying to follow a tutorial from a training site that covers databases and uses peewee. If youre not sure which to choose, learn more about installing. Most public apis are compatible with mysqlclient and mysqldb. Among the new major new features and changes in the 3. Linux kernel data structures part 1 the current macro. I have added to the downloads page two distributions of the mysql python module 1. How to connect python to mysql using mysqldb data to fish. In this tutorial, youll learn how to set up mysql database in python. Download python3 mysqldb packages for debian, ubuntu.
414 387 1288 1207 1329 656 1096 1034 184 1226 85 458 1202 1310 20 1566 807 1275 773 1582 961 285 960 478 1139 1479 919 247 983 699 542 99 459 150 298 1051 640 95 1308